Homeless Men Fight Over Begging Turf

Jan 19, 2012 at 12:52 pm by Unknown


A retired police officer who tried to help out a homeless person on Wednesday got more than he bargained for.  The Good Samaritan told Murfreesboro Police that he gave cash to a man who was holding up a sign asking for money. After he handed the man money, a second homeless person approached the two and stated, “this is my turf.”  The incident occurred in front of Walmart on Old Fort Parkway. The retired officer took up for the homeless person whom he gave the money to and that was when the second homeless man pulled out a knife. The Good Samaritan told officers he quickly pulled out his retired police badge and the man with the knife ran into the woods. By the time police got to the scene, the culprit was nowhere to be found. No arrest could be made.
